The S07K680E2 is a varistor from EPCOS (TDK), designed for transient voltage suppression. It's part of the S series, which is recognized for its small size and reliable performance in protecting electronic circuits from overvoltage events. The 7mm disk diameter allows for use in compact applications.

Varistors are voltage-dependent resistors that exhibit a highly non-linear current-voltage characteristic. When the voltage across the varistor exceeds its clamping voltage, the resistance of the varistor rapidly decreases, diverting the surge current away from the protected components. This helps to prevent damage caused by overvoltage conditions.
